Who Is Eligible?
FHA loan eligibility is set by the FHA and applied by Synchrony’s underwriting team to determine borrower qualification. Typical eligibility considerations include:
- Credit score: A minimum credit score is required to qualify for the 3.5% down payment option; applicants with lower scores may still qualify with higher down payments.
- Debt-to-income ratio: FHA guidelines allow higher DTI ratios in many cases, subject to verification of income and compensating factors.
- Primary residence requirement: FHA loans are intended for owner-occupied properties; the borrower must intend to live in the home as their primary residence.
- Property condition: The home must meet HUD’s minimum property standards to ensure safety, soundness, and security.
- Legal residency and documentation: Borrowers must provide proof of lawful residency and verifiable income documentation such as pay stubs, tax returns, and bank statements.
Types of FHA Loans Available
Synchrony’s FHA product suite can include several FHA-insured mortgage types to meet varying borrower needs:
- FHA Purchase Loans: For buyers seeking to acquire a primary residence with a low down payment and flexible credit guidelines.
- FHA Streamline Refinance: For existing FHA borrowers looking to refinance into a lower rate with minimal documentation and appraisal requirements under qualifying conditions.
- FHA Cash-Out Refinance: Allows qualifying homeowners to convert home equity into cash for debt consolidation, home improvements, or other needs, subject to FHA limits.
- FHA 203(k) Rehabilitation Loans: For borrowers purchasing or refinancing a property in need of repairs; this program finances both purchase and rehab work in a single FHA-insured mortgage when eligible.
Costs and Mortgage Insurance
FHA loans include mortgage insurance premiums that borrowers should consider when comparing loan options. An upfront mortgage insurance premium (UFMIP) is typically financed into the loan amount or paid at closing, and a monthly MIP is required until certain conditions for cancellation are met. Important Considerations
- Mortgage insurance duration: FHA mortgage insurance may remain for the life of the loan depending on down payment and loan term; borrowers should evaluate long-term costs versus short-term benefits.
- Property standards: FHA appraisal and inspection requirements focus on safety and structural soundness, which may require repairs before closing.
- Loan limits: FHA sets maximum loan amounts that vary by region and property type; Synchrony will disclose applicable limits during the process.
- Down payment sources: Down payment funds can often come from gifts or approved assistance programs; Synchrony can explain eligible sources and documentation requirements.
- Refinance planning: Borrowers with FHA loans should monitor market conditions to determine if a refinance to a conventional mortgage could eliminate MIP and reduce long-term costs.
